CANNES, France (AP) — The "Hunger Games" is back in Cannes with a fiery billboard to promote the upcoming "Mockingjay: Part 1."
Just as the Lionsgate franchise did last year, it has blazed the front of the Majestic Barriere Hotel with a large video promotion. Even among the many advertisements erected at the Cannes Film Festival, the "Mockingjay" presence is eye-catching.
Lionsgate will also host a lavish party to promote the film, the first of a two-part final installment, on Saturday. The movie, starring Jennifer Lawrence as Katniss Everdeen, isn't due out until November, but Cannes offers a rare chance to capture the attention of the world's entertainment media.
